LU-VE Acquires Spirotech of India
20 February 2017

Lu-Ve S.p.A. has acquired Spirotech Heat Exchangers Private Limited, a leading Indian company engaged in the production and sale of heat exchangers. Lu-Ve, through its
subsidiary Lu-Ve India, has acquired 95% of the share capital of Spirotech, with the option to acquire the remaining 5% owned by S. Srinivasan, one of the founding partners,
who will continue as the Managing Director. The other founding partner, Rajeshwar Kumar Malhotra, will continue as Chairman of the Board of Directors. A presentation to
the market was made by Lu-Ve on October 11 in Nuremberg during Chillventa 2016, in the presence of Rajeshwar Kumar Malhotra, Matteo Liberali (CEO, Lu-Ve Group) and Fabio Liberali (Chief Communications Officer, Lu-Ve Group). The equity capital of Spirotech has been valued at €33.6 million. In the financial year ending March 2016, Spirotech registered a turnover of approximately €21 million, with an EBITDA of €4.5 million and a net profit of €2.2 million.
